2005 Audi S4 vs. 2001 GMC Safari

To start off, 2005 Audi S4 is newer by 4 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2001 GMC Safari.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2001 GMC Safari would be higher. At 4,293 cc (6 cylinders), 2001 GMC Safari is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Audi S4 (340 HP @ 6300 RPM) has 153 more horse power than 2001 GMC Safari. (187 HP @ 4400 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Audi S4 should accelerate faster than 2001 GMC Safari.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2001 GMC Safari weights approximately 220 kg more than 2005 Audi S4.

Let's talk about torque, 2005 Audi S4 (410 Nm) has 72 more torque (in Nm) than 2001 GMC Safari. (338 Nm). This means 2005 Audi S4 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2001 GMC Safari.
